medi models are realistic representations of human anatomy, physiology, and pathology that are used for a variety of purposes in the healthcare industry. These models can range from simple anatomical models used for educational purposes to advanced surgical simulators that mimic specific medical procedures. By using medi models, healthcare professionals can enhance their knowledge and skills in a risk-free environment, ultimately leading to improved patient safety and quality of care.

One of the primary benefits of medi models is their ability to provide hands-on training and practice opportunities for healthcare professionals. Traditionally, medical training relied heavily on textbooks, lectures, and observation of procedures. While these methods are still valuable, medi models offer a more immersive and interactive learning experience. For example, surgical simulators can be used to practice complex procedures such as laparoscopic surgery or robotic surgery, allowing surgeons to hone their skills and improve surgical outcomes.

In addition to training, medi models also play a crucial role in research and development within the healthcare industry. Researchers can use these models to study anatomy, test new medical devices, and simulate different healthcare scenarios. By conducting studies using medi models, researchers can gather valuable data and insights that can ultimately lead to advancements in patient care and treatment strategies.

Furthermore, medi models offer a safe and controlled environment for healthcare professionals to practice their skills and troubleshoot potential challenges. Mistakes made on medi models do not have real-life consequences, allowing practitioners to learn from their errors and improve their techniques without putting patients at risk. This not only benefits individual healthcare professionals but also contributes to overall healthcare quality and safety.

The use of medi models also extends beyond training and research to patient education and communication. Many healthcare facilities use medi models to explain medical conditions, procedures, and treatment options to patients in a visual and easily understandable way. By using these models, healthcare providers can improve patient understanding, compliance, and satisfaction, ultimately leading to better health outcomes.
